The key fob plays an essential function in securing your vehicle. It's equipped with a transponder, which communicates with the computer of your vehicle. This is your primary protection against theft or copying of the key. The metal part of a classic key is easily copied, but the true security lies in the electronic components within the case. If you lose a key, or have a damaged one that won't turn on the ignition, you'll require a new one.

You can save money by doing this yourself. A Saab dealer may charge you the cost of a replacement. It's a straightforward process that requires only a few tools. Begin by removing the emergency key from the fob, then employ a flathead screwdriver split the case open. This will reveal your battery. Remove the old batteries and replace them with brand new ones.
Once you've done this you'll need to re-synchronize your new key. This can be accomplished using a tool that is specifically designed for this purpose, called Tech2. Tech2. The NG 9-3 keys are mated to the CIM (Column Integration Module) or TWICE (Theft Warning Integrated Central Electronics), and can't be added using the normal keys.
